50 Pieces Of Balmain Items Stolen Via Robbery, Days Before Its Paris Fashion Week Show
BALMAIN’S ARTISTIC DIRECTOR OLIVIER ROUSTEING REPORTED THAT THE LUXURY HOUSE HAD DOZENS OF ITEMS FROM ITS UPCOMING SPRING COLLECTION STOLEN.
PARIS, FRANCE — A vehicle carrying pieces from Balmain‘s spring 2024 collection was carjacked on its way to the fashion house’s headquarters.

“This morning I woke up with the smile, starting the fittings for my next show at 9 a.m. and this is what happened…50 Balmain pieces stolen. Our delivery was hijacked. The [truck] got stolen. Thank god, the driver is safe,” the designer wrote in a message to his 9.8 million followers.
“So many people worked so hard to make this collection happen. We are redoing everything but this is so so disrespectful,” he continued.
“So many workers, suppliers, my team and I. Please be safe, this is the world we are living in. Love you my Balmain team and we won’t give up,” he concluded.
The show scheduled for Sept. 27 near the Eiffel Tower would still go ahead as planned.
